第1题:
下列说法不正确的是( )
A.下列结构体定义时,占据了5个字节的空间 struct s {int num; int age; char sex; }
B.结构体的成员名可以与程序中的变量名相同
C.对结构体中的成员可以单独使用,它的作用相当于普通变量
D.结构体的成员可以是一个结构体变量
第2题:
假定要访问一个结构指针变量x中的数据成员a,则表示方法为()。
Ax.a
Bx->a
Cx(a)
Dx{a}
第3题:
以下定义的结构体类型拟包含两个成员,其中成员变量info用来存入整形数据;成员变量link是指向自身结构体的指针,请将定义补充完整。
struct node
{ int info;
【19】link;
};
第4题:
结构体变量中的成员的引用一般形式:()。
第5题:
下列关于结构类型与结构变量的说法中,错误的是()
第6题:
以下叙述中错误的是
A.只要类型相同,结构体变量之间可以整体赋值
B.函数的返回值类型不能是结构体类型,只能是简单类型
C.可以通过指针变量来访问结构体变量的任何成员
D.函数可以返回指向结构体变量的指针
第7题:
表示结构成员的形式是:结构变量()
第8题:
以下叙述中错误的是( )。
A.函数的返回值类型不能是结构体类型,只能是简单类型
B.函数可以返回指向结构体变量的指针
C.可以通过指向结构体变量的指针访问所指结构体变量的任何成员
D.只要类型相同,结构体变量之间可以整体赋值
第9题:
访问数据结构中成员的方式通常使用“结构名.成员名”形式
第10题:
对象成员的表示方法与结构变量成员的表示方法相同。